4.55 pm: Early finish to this chase, thanks to some marvelous big-hitting by Smeed, Allen and Livingstone. The Hundred is not yet done for the weekend however, so stick around for the other games. The Southern Brave Women's chase is on against London Spirit Women. And in about an hour, the Southern Brave Men will face off against the London Spirit Men.

Will Smeed: Got a call last night (that he would play) and I was buzzing. The biggest stage I've played on, got into it quickly. Bit of nerves. I thought me and Finn will go out there and just play freely. Every batter loves batting in the powerplay in white-ball cricket, it's the best time to bat. I've sort of batted everywhere at Somerset this year, due to injuries.

4.48 pm: Two valuable points for Phoenix and they're in the top four now. Significant improvement in NRR too. Rockets still top the table but their net run-rate has taken a hit.
